About Converting Micrograms per Fluid ounce to Picograms per Cubic Centimeter
Microgram per Fluid ounce and Picogram per Cubic Centimeter both measure density — mass per unit volume — a property used to identify materials, check manufacturing quality, and predict whether something floats or sinks. As a fixed reference point, water has a density of exactly 1000 kg/m³ (1 g/cm³, 1 g/mL) at its temperature of maximum density, which is why many density figures in science and engineering are quoted relative to water. Both are mass per volume density units.
Formula
picograms per cubic centimeter = micrograms per fluid ounce × 33814.0227018
This factor comes from each unit's defined relationship to the category's base unit: 1 microgram per fluid ounce equals 0.0000338140227018 base units, and 1 picogram per cubic centimeter equals 1e-9 base units, so dividing one by the other gives the direct microgram per fluid ounce-to-picogram per cubic centimeter factor of 33814.0227018.

What's the difference between density and mass concentration?
Density is the mass of a pure substance or material per unit volume. Mass concentration is the mass of one component — like a dissolved solute — within a mixture's total volume. The two use the same kind of units but describe different physical situations.
